FlexChart入门教程:基于ArcGIS的Flex开发

需积分: 10 1 下载量 127 浏览量 更新于2024-07-25 收藏 780KB DOC 举报
"FlexChart使用教程是一份基于ArcGIS的开发资料,专注于讲解如何使用FlexChart进行开发。教程适用于学习ArcGIS Flex开发的人员,强调深入理解和实践FlexChart的运用。" 在这篇教程中,主要介绍了以下几个核心知识点: 1. FlexChart介绍:FlexChart是用于创建图表和图形的组件,常用于数据可视化,尤其是在ArcGIS开发中。它是Flex库的一部分,能够帮助开发者创建出交互式的、动态的数据展示。 2. 准备阶段:在开始FlexChart的开发之前,你需要下载并安装FlexBuild3或FlexEclipse插件。FlexBuild3包含了Flex SDK,这是一个类似Java JDK的编译器,它提供了一个集成开发环境(IDE)来编写和编译Flex应用程序。 3. 开发阶段 - 创建工程:在FlexBuild3中创建一个新的Flex项目,通过"New -> FlexProject"菜单选项。在这个过程中,需要设定项目名称、位置以及选择应用程序类型。对于简单应用,一般默认设置即可,直接点击"Finish"完成创建。 4. Flex项目结构:新创建的Flex项目包含几个关键目录,如`src`存储源文件(`.mxml`、`.as`、`.css`等),`bin-debug`用于存放编译后的`.swf`文件,`html-template`和`libs`则分别用于HTML模板和库文件。`.mxml`文件是XML格式,用于定义界面结构和样式,而`.as`文件则是ActionScript代码,负责程序逻辑。 5. 开发模式:FlexBuild3提供了两种开发模式,设计模式和代码编写模式。设计模式允许开发者直观地在设计面板上添加和布局控件,而代码编写模式则用于编写标签和脚本控制应用行为。两种模式可以通过编辑器上的"Source"和"Design"按钮切换。 6. 设计视图与属性编辑:设计模式下,开发者可以从左侧的控件库中拖放元素到设计面板,并在右侧调整其属性。这提供了一种直观的方式来构建和定制用户界面。 7. 代码编写模式:在代码编写模式下,开发者直接编写`.mxml`和`.as`文件,用ActionScript语法来定义控件和处理逻辑。这种模式更适合熟悉编程的开发者,他们可以通过代码实现更复杂的功能。 8. 开发实例:教程以创建一个简单的应用为例,指导开发者如何准备测试数据,如创建一个名为`data.xml`的文件来存储数据。这展示了在实际开发中如何结合XML文件来驱动图表的数据。 这个FlexChart使用教程为开发者提供了从基础到实践的指导,涵盖了环境配置、项目创建、界面设计、代码编写和数据绑定等多个方面,旨在帮助学习者掌握使用FlexChart进行数据可视化开发的技能。